The Best of Both Worlds: Ocean Breezes and Bay Adventures

The community is thoughtfully laid out, bisected by the coastal highway. To the east, a pristine, life-guarded beach offers the classic sun-and-surf experience without the overwhelming crowds of other resorts. To the west lies the heart of the community: a five-mile network of deepwater canals that weaves through the neighborhood. This intricate system provides hundreds of homes with private docks and direct access to the Little Assawoman Bay.

From Marshland to Marina: The History of the Harbor

The story of South Bethany Harbor is a testament to mid-20th-century ambition. In 1952, developers Richard and Elizabeth Hall transformed 130 acres of marshland into a waterfront community. Their vision was to create a haven where every property owner could enjoy the water, which led to the ambitious project of digging five miles of canals. This engineered waterway system is the defining feature that turned a simple coastal development into a premier boating destination. This history is important for homeowners to understand, as the health and maintenance of this man-made canal system are vital to the community's long-term value.

Typical Property Profile

The vast majority of properties are single-family homes, with typical layouts featuring three to seven bedrooms and two to five bathrooms. Sizes range from cozy 1,500-square-foot cottages to luxurious residences exceeding 3,500 square feet, catering to a wide variety of needs, from small families to large multi-generational groups.

A True Boater's Paradise

The canal system is more than just a scenic backdrop; it's a gateway to endless aquatic adventure.

Unrivaled Access and Connectivity

From a private dock in South Bethany Harbor, you have unimpeded access to the Little Assawoman Bay. From there, your options are vast. Head north through the historic Assawoman Canal to explore the Indian River and Rehoboth Bays. Head south to the larger Assawoman Bay, which provides access to the Atlantic Ocean through the Ocean City Inlet. This incredible connectivity makes the community a hub for boaters who want to explore the rich and diverse waterways of the Delmarva Peninsula.

A Look at the Real Estate Market

The real estate market in South Bethany Harbor is robust, characterized by high demand and limited inventory. For a prospective buyer, this translates to a stable and appreciating investment.

Current Market Conditions

Inventory is consistently tight, resulting in a highly competitive environment. The average list price for a home in South Bethany Harbor typically hovers around $1.6 million, with a wide range reflecting the diversity of the housing stock. Well-priced homes often sell quickly, underscoring the area's desirability.

Community Life and Governance

South Bethany operates with a dual governance structure: a formal municipal government and an active, voluntary property owners association.

  • The Town of South Bethany: As an incorporated town, it provides essential services, including a local police department and a seasonal beach patrol, ensuring the community remains safe and well-managed.
  • South Bethany Property Owners Association (SBPOA): Unlike a mandatory HOA, the SBPOA is a voluntary organization that serves as a powerful advocate for residents. It organizes beloved community events like the Fourth of July Boat Parade and keeps homeowners informed, fostering a strong sense of community and collaborative stewardship.

The Practicalities of Ownership

Prospective buyers should be aware of the ongoing costs of coastal homeownership.

  • Property Taxes: Delaware is known for its low property taxes, offering a significant financial advantage. It's important to note that Sussex County is undergoing a property reassessment, with new tax rates expected in 2025.
  • Flood Insurance: Due to its location, flood insurance is an essential and often mandatory expense. The Town of South Bethany participates in the National Flood Insurance Program (NFIP), making federally backed policies available to homeowners.
